Carson City
Carson City has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$36,198. Population has declined 8% since 2000. Median home value is $91,400. Households here earn about 25% less than the Michigan median.

How many people live in Carson City, Michigan?
Carson City, Michigan has about 1,093 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Carson City, Michigan?
The typical household in Carson City, Michigan earns about $36,198 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Carson City, Michigan expensive?
In Carson City, Michigan, the median home is worth about $91,400, and the typical rent is about $514 a month.
How educated are people in Carson City, Michigan?
About 23.3% of adults age 25 and over in Carson City, Michigan h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Carson City, Michigan?
About 11.7% of people in Carson City, Michigan live below the federal poverty line.
